Key Points

Positve
  • ElringKlinger AG (EGKLF) reported a 17% year-over-year revenue increase to EUR479 million in Q2 2026, significantly outpacing the declining global automotive market.
  • E-mobility sales more than doubled year-over-year to EUR85 million in Q2 2026, now accounting for 18% of total group sales, with a clear path to double 2025 sales by 2028.
  • Adjusted EBIT rose 19% year-over-year to EUR29 million, driven by EUR12 million in operational improvements and disciplined cost management.
  • Operating free cash flow surged 118% year-over-year to EUR52 million, with a strong 10.8% ratio, reflecting improved working capital management.
  • The aftermarket segment continued its strong performance, with sales up 7% to EUR102 million and a robust adjusted EBIT margin of 19.8%.
  • The Shape 30 strategy is on track, with over half of the Shape to Empower work streams completed, supporting long-term efficiency and profitability goals.
Negative
  • Global light vehicle production is forecast to decline by 2.1% in 2026, with Greater China expected to see a 4.6% reduction, intensifying market headwinds.
  • E-mobility remains in a ramp-up phase, posting an adjusted EBIT loss of EUR8.1 million in Q2 2026, though improved from the prior year.
  • The OE segment excluding e-mobility saw its adjusted EBIT margin decline quarter-over-quarter to 4.8%, attributed to an unfavorable product mix.
  • The company faces ongoing challenges from geopolitical tensions, trade conflicts, and inflationary pressures, creating uncertainty across global markets.
  • CFO Isabelle Damen will leave the company at the end of 2026, potentially creating leadership transition risks during a critical transformation phase.
  • Revenue growth was partly boosted by a EUR28 million one-time effect from tooling/equipment sales, which had zero to low margin, masking underlying organic growth quality.
